verb
- jumps over or across something
- goes beyond proper or reasonable limits; exceeds
Usage: often used figuratively
Examples
- The athlete overleaps the hurdle with ease.
- The deer overleaps the fallen log in the forest.
- His ambition overleaps his actual abilities.
- The new policy overleaps traditional boundaries.
- She overleaps the small stream during her hike.
- The company’s expansion overleaps market demand.
